【问题标题】:Find the location of the SASS executable. (using rbenv)找到 SASS 可执行文件的位置。 (使用 rbenv)
【发布时间】:2013-08-23 18:37:51
【问题描述】:

我有一个有效的 SASS 安装。我可以在终端中运行这些命令并获得以下输出:

sass -v
Sass 3.2.9 (Media Mark)

rbenv versions
  system
* 1.9.3-p392 (set by /Users/Eric/.rbenv/version)
  2.0.0-p0

我需要找到可执行文件,以便可以将其作为文件观察程序提供给 Webstorm IDE。 http://blog.jetbrains.com/webide/2013/03/file-watchers-in-webstormphpstorm-6-a-k-a-background-tasks/。我之前在其他环境(windows、osx 没有 rbenv)中设置了这个,但在这里不知道怎么做。

如果我运行whereis sass,我没有输出。

我如何找到这个可执行文件并为 Webstorm 指定它?

深入研究 rbenv,我在这里看到: /Users/Eric/.rbenv/versions/1.9.3-p392/lib/ruby/gems/1.9.1/gems/sass-3.2.9/bin/sass 指定此路径到 webstorm 确实有效。直接引用此位置是否合适/稳定,还是有更好的方法不依赖于版本号?

【问题讨论】:

标签: gem sass webstorm rbenv


【解决方案1】:

这对我来说是一个可行的答案:

/Users/Eric/.rbenv/versions/1.9.3-p392/lib/ruby/gems/1.9.1/gems/sass-3.2.9/bin/sass

这不是最好的,因为我在升级 SASS 时必须更新位置,但它可以正常工作。希望这对其他人有帮助。

如果有人知道通过 rbenv 或 ruby​​ 升级维护的可执行文件的符号链接,请分享。

【讨论】:

    【解决方案2】:

    使用which sass 代替whereis。它应该在您的~/.rbenv/bin 位置。

    【讨论】:

      猜你喜欢
      • 2016-05-07
      • 1970-01-01
      • 1970-01-01
      • 2018-07-05
      • 2014-11-09
      • 1970-01-01
      • 2010-10-30
      相关资源
      最近更新 更多